The difference between manual scheduling and auto scheduling in Microsoft Project mainly lies in how task dates and durations are controlled.

Manual Scheduling

In manual scheduling, the user has full control over task dates, duration, and dependencies.

Tasks do not automatically adjust when changes occur elsewhere in the project.

You can enter dates freely, even if they conflict with dependencies or constraints.

Best for early planning stages when details are not fixed.

πŸ‘‰ Example: If you delay one task, other linked tasks won’t move automatically.

Auto Scheduling

In auto scheduling, MS Project automatically calculates task dates based on dependencies, constraints, and calendars.

When one task changes, related tasks adjust automatically.

Helps maintain a realistic and accurate schedule.

Best for detailed planning and execution phases.

πŸ‘‰ Example: If a task is delayed, all dependent tasks shift accordingly.
